How the Concept Works
Typically, a casino theme party is structured around a set of stations or areas that mimic various types of games found in traditional casinos. These can range from roulette, blackjack, craps, poker, or slots machines, among others. Guests are usually given fake money (in the form of play money or chips) to wager on these games, with winning participants often receiving prizes, rewards, or bragging rights.
The gameplay and rules may be slightly modified for a party setting, making it more accessible and engaging for participants who might not have experience with real-money gaming. Experienced hosts can provide explanations and guidance throughout the event, helping guests navigate the various stations and activities.

Legal or Regional Context
Regulations surrounding real-money gaming in many countries limit where and how such events can be held legally. Some regions may have strict laws regarding private games of chance or require explicit licensing for hosting cash-based tournaments. Hosts should familiarize themselves with local regulations before planning a casino-themed event, particularly if they involve wagering.
Free Play, Demo Modes, or Non-Monetary Options
Casino theme parties often eliminate the financial aspect by using play money, providing an equal playing field where guests can focus on socializing and entertainment. In some instances, participants may earn rewards, points, or redeemable prizes for participating in specific games or achieving certain milestones within the party.
This format allows organizers to host events that are inclusive and risk-free, as no financial transactions occur during these parties. The emphasis shifts from potential winnings to enjoyable interaction among guests.
